Lithium-rich granitic pegmatites. Forms a series with analcime. |
Valid Species (Pre-IMA) 1846 |
Elba, Italy Link to MinDat.org Location Data. |
Named after Pollux, a figure from Greek mythology, brother of Castor, for its common association with "castorite" (petalite). |
